Responsibilities: QSW/Experienced QSW Deliver effective services that promote and safeguard the welfare of children and young people at various stages of their journey. Have knowledge and experience of Safeguarding and of legislation, regulations and guidance relating to Children's social care together with an ability to assess and manage risk. Duty. Manage a complex caseload. Work in conjunction with partner agencies to deliver effective planning for children and families. Representing the Council at a range of meetings, proceedings and reviews as required. Taking referrals from MASH. Includes assessments and child in need intervention. Advanced Practitioner To support staff, including reflective and group supervision, assistance in reflecting on quality of performance as a team and for individuals within the service, and giving technical advice and guidance to staff. Assisting the team manager in making sense of quality assurance feedback and data, promoting a learning culture sharing good practice and strengths as well as identifying areas for development and finding ways to ensure consistent high quality. To model continual professional development and be accountable for the promotion of social work, good practice and learning from research. The caseload is expected to be at approx. 60% to allow for the time and space to deliver the other elements of the role. Team Manager To manage and provide leadership to a team of social work and social care staff, which could include staff from other agencies. To co-ordinate the team's activities and ensure delivery is flexible, reliable, and responsive to the needs of Service Users, Carers and Families. To make a strategic contribution to the wider development of the Service. Please note more information on the duties can be provided upon request.
